How does the travel restriction apply to U S Citizens? COVID-19 USA Immigration-Related FAQs
Effective 5 p.m. EST on Sunday, February 2, the following restrictions on U.S. citizens returning from travels in China were implemented: Any U.S. citizen returning to the United States who had been in Hubei province in the 14 days prior to their entry to the United States will be subject to up to 14 days of mandatory quarantine to ensure they have been properly screened and provided medical care as needed Any U.S. citizen returning to the United States who had been anywhere else in mainland China in the 14 days prior to their entry to the United States will undergo “proactive entry health screening at a select number of ports of entry,” and up to 14 days of “monitored self-quarantine” to ensure they’ve not contracted the virus and do not pose a public health risk. Effective 5 p.m. EST on Monday, March 2, 2020, it should be assumed that these same restrictions will apply to U.S. citizens returning from travels to Iran.
